First and foremost, digital handheld slit lamps offer unprecedented portability. Unlike traditional slit lamps that are often bulky and stationary, these handheld devices are lightweight and compact. This portability allows clinicians to perform eye examinations in a variety of settings, including clinics, home visits, and even during emergency situations. The practicality of being able to conduct thorough assessments anywhere can significantly improve patient care and access to ophthalmic services.
Secondly, the integration of digital technology allows for enhanced imaging capabilities. Digital handheld slit lamps come equipped with high-resolution cameras that capture detailed images of the anterior segment of the eye. These images can be easily stored, analyzed, and shared with other healthcare professionals, facilitating better collaborative care. In 2025, as telemedicine continues to gain traction, having high-quality digital images will be crucial for remote consultations and follow-up assessments.
Another significant advantage is the user-friendly interface of these modern devices. With intuitive controls and touchscreen technology, even less experienced practitioners can quickly learn to operate digital handheld slit lamps. This ease of use reduces the training time required and increases confidence in performing nuanced eye examinations. The streamlined workflow ultimately enhances overall effectiveness in patient assessments, benefiting both clinicians and their patients.
Furthermore, digital handheld slit lamps contribute to improved patient comfort and experience. Traditional slit lamps often require patients to remain in uncomfortable positions for extended periods, leading to a less pleasant examination experience. In contrast, the handheld design allows for more flexibility, with patients able to be examined in various comfortable positions. This not only alleviates patient anxiety but also promotes a more positive perception of eye care services.
Lastly, these devices are increasingly becoming recognized for their cost-effectiveness in the long run. While the initial investment in digital handheld slit lamps may be higher than traditional options, their durability, low maintenance costs, and advanced features can lead to significant savings over time. Additionally, the ability to quickly and accurately diagnose and treat eye conditions can lead to better patient outcomes, translated into fewer costly interventions in the future.
